Jonah’s Prayer

1 (a)Then Jonah prayed to the Lord his God (A)from the stomach of the fish, 2 and he said,
“I (B)called out of my distress to the Lord,
And He answered me.
I cried for help from the (b)depth of (C)Sheol;
You heard my voice.
3
“For You had (D)cast me into the deep,
Into the heart of the seas,
And the current (c)engulfed me.
All Your (E)breakers and billows passed over me.
4
“So I said, ‘I have been (F)expelled from (d)Your sight.
Nevertheless I will look again (G)toward Your holy temple.’
5
(H)Water encompassed me to the (e)point of death.
The great (I)deep (f)engulfed me,
Weeds were wrapped around my head.
6
“I (J)descended to the roots of the mountains.
The earth with its (K)bars was around me forever,
But You have (L)brought up my life from (g)the pit, O Lord my God.
7
“While (h)I was (M)fainting away,
I (N)remembered the Lord,
And my (O)prayer came to You,
Into (P)Your holy temple.
8
“Those who (Q)regard (i)vain idols
Forsake their faithfulness,
9
But I will (R)sacrifice to You
With the voice of thanksgiving.
That which I have vowed I will (S)pay.
(T)Salvation is from the Lord.”
10 Then the Lord commanded the (U)fish, and it vomited Jonah up onto the dry land.
